This is a full list of the 372 tribes in Nigeria and the states in which they reside.. … WebEvidence of human occupation in Nigeria dates back thousands of years. The oldest fossil remains found by archaeologists in the southwestern area of Iwo Eleru, near Akure, have been dated to about 9000 bce.
